An oil filter is a device that is used in an engine to remove impurities and contaminants from the engine oil. The filter is typically a cylindrical shape and is usually made of a paper-like material.


As the engine oil circulates through the engine, the oil filter traps and removes particles, such as dirt, metal shavings, and other debris, from the oil before it returns to the engine. This helps to protect the engine from damage and extend its lifespan.

Over time, the oil filter will become clogged with contaminants and will need to be replaced to maintain proper engine performance. It is generally recommended to change the oil filter every time the oil is changed, which is typically every 5,000 to 10,000 miles, depending on the manufacturer's recommendations.
